Delhi Lost, Aura Lost?

Delhi was once considered Arvind Kejriwal’s political fortress.

His governance model based on free electricity, water, education, and healthcare had made him one of the biggest faces of opposition politics in India.

But after losing power, Kejriwal now appears to be playing defensive politics.

The man who once spoke of “new politics” now finds himself constantly forced to defend his own image and credibility.

Courts, Allegations, and an Aggressive BJP

The Delhi excise policy case continues to haunt Kejriwal politically.

Even though he received relief from a lower court, the legal battle is far from over.

The BJP continues to attack him aggressively on corruption allegations, while Kejriwal insists the cases are politically motivated attempts to crush the opposition.

But for the public, the debate is no longer just legal — it has also become moral.

The politics that began in the name of honesty now faces questions over its own credibility.
